| Index: Source/modules/mediastream/MediaStream.h
 | 
| diff --git a/Source/modules/mediastream/MediaStream.h b/Source/modules/mediastream/MediaStream.h
 | 
| index 7e6748ee92c6a746dcdb46e7016560272adcd907..50767ae16c35df33b9da0ca100e20d9ab3c741b2 100644
 | 
| --- a/Source/modules/mediastream/MediaStream.h
 | 
| +++ b/Source/modules/mediastream/MediaStream.h
 | 
| @@ -45,12 +45,12 @@ class MediaStream FINAL
 | 
|      , public ContextLifecycleObserver {
 | 
|      DEFINE_EVENT_TARGET_REFCOUNTING_WILL_BE_REMOVED(RefCountedGarbageCollectedWillBeGarbageCollectedFinalized<MediaStream>);
 | 
|      DEFINE_WRAPPERTYPEINFO();
 | 
| -    WILL_BE_USING_GARBAGE_COLLECTED_MIXIN(MediaStream);
 | 
| +    USING_GARBAGE_COLLECTED_MIXIN(MediaStream);
 | 
|  public:
 | 
|      static MediaStream* create(ExecutionContext*);
 | 
|      static MediaStream* create(ExecutionContext*, MediaStream*);
 | 
|      static MediaStream* create(ExecutionContext*, const MediaStreamTrackVector&);
 | 
| -    static MediaStream* create(ExecutionContext*, PassRefPtr<MediaStreamDescriptor>);
 | 
| +    static MediaStream* create(ExecutionContext*, MediaStreamDescriptor*);
 | 
|      virtual ~MediaStream();
 | 
|  
 | 
|      // DEPRECATED
 | 
| @@ -91,7 +91,7 @@ public:
 | 
|      virtual void trace(Visitor*) OVERRIDE;
 | 
|  
 | 
|  private:
 | 
| -    MediaStream(ExecutionContext*, PassRefPtr<MediaStreamDescriptor>);
 | 
| +    MediaStream(ExecutionContext*, MediaStreamDescriptor*);
 | 
|      MediaStream(ExecutionContext*, const MediaStreamTrackVector& audioTracks, const MediaStreamTrackVector& videoTracks);
 | 
|  
 | 
|      // ContextLifecycleObserver
 | 
| @@ -108,7 +108,7 @@ private:
 | 
|  
 | 
|      MediaStreamTrackVector m_audioTracks;
 | 
|      MediaStreamTrackVector m_videoTracks;
 | 
| -    RefPtr<MediaStreamDescriptor> m_descriptor;
 | 
| +    Member<MediaStreamDescriptor> m_descriptor;
 | 
|  
 | 
|      Timer<MediaStream> m_scheduledEventTimer;
 | 
|      WillBeHeapVector<RefPtrWillBeMember<Event> > m_scheduledEvents;
 | 
| 
 |